JANTXV2N5665-Transistor Overview
The JANTXV2N5665 is a high-performance NPN bipolar junction transistor designed for industrial and military applications requiring robust switching and amplification capabilities. Built to stringent JAN (Joint Army-Navy) standards, this transistor guarantees reliability and consistent performance under harsh environmental conditions. It features a maximum collector-emitter voltage of 60V and a collector current rating of 1A, making it suitable for medium power applications. The device??s low noise and high gain characteristics enhance signal integrity and efficiency in critical circuits. JANTXV2N5665-Transistor Technical Specifications
| Parameter | Symbol | Value | Unit |
|---|---|---|---|
| Collector-Emitter Voltage | VCEO | 60 | V |
| Collector-Base Voltage | VCBO | 80 | V |
| Emitter-Base Voltage | VEBO | 7 | V |
| Collector Current (Continuous) | IC | 1 | A |
| Power Dissipation | PD | 625 | mW |
| DC Current Gain (hFE) | hFE | 40 to 160 | ?? |
| Transition Frequency | fT | 100 | MHz |
| Operating Temperature Range | Top | -55 to +125 | ??C |
